The ideal dosage of Ferric Sulphate is not a one-size-fits-all figure. It depends heavily on several factors, including the characteristics of the raw water or wastewater being treated. Key parameters to consider include the influent's turbidity, pH, temperature, alkalinity, and the concentration of suspended solids and dissolved organic matter. For instance, water with higher turbidity or a greater concentration of contaminants will likely require a higher dosage of Ferric Sulphate to achieve adequate coagulation and flocculation.
The most effective way to determine the optimal dosage is through laboratory jar testing. This process involves simulating the treatment conditions by adding varying amounts of Ferric Sulphate to samples of the water. By observing the formation of flocs, their settling rate, and the clarity of the treated water, one can identify the minimum dosage that yields the best results. The pH of the water is also a critical factor influencing Ferric Sulphate's performance. Ferric Sulphate is an acidic compound and tends to lower the pH. While it can operate over a wide pH range, there is often an optimal pH window where its coagulant efficiency is maximized. If the raw water's pH is significantly outside this optimal range, adjustments using pH control agents might be necessary. When you inquire about how to use Ferric Sulphate, consider that it is often prepared as a liquid solution before application. The concentration of this prepared solution also plays a role in the overall dosage calculation. Generally, the dosage of Ferric Sulphate is compared to other coagulants like aluminum sulfate; often, it requires roughly 1/3 to 1/4 the dosage of solid aluminum sulfate for similar results.
